The Ogun State Commissioner of Police, Lanre Ogunlowo, has announced comprehensive security arrangements for the Eid-ul-Kabir celebration, deploying specialized units across the state to ensure public safety.
According to a statement released on Thursday, specialized units including SWAT, Monitoring, Anti-Kidnapping, and Anti-Cultism squads have been strategically positioned at key locations throughout Ogun State to prevent crime and ensure a hitch-free Sallah celebration.
Strategic Deployment Plan
The security arrangement covers praying grounds, public facilities, banks, and recreational centers statewide. CP Ogunlowo has also enhanced extended patrols in collaboration with sister agencies at identified flash points including Onigari, Ayetoro, Ijebu-Ode, Sagamu Interchange, Long Bridge, Alapako, Ogunmakin, and Abeokuta.
"The Commissioner of Police, CP Lanre Ogunlowo Ph.D., has deployed extensive motorized patrol and tactical assets across the state to ensure a crime-free Sallah," stated police spokesperson Omolola Odutola in the release made available to BenriNews.
The statement further explained that Divisional Police Officers, under the supervision of Area Commanders, will actively patrol their jurisdictions while joint task force operations with sister agencies will secure border towns.
Call for Public Cooperation
While extending his felicitations to Muslim faithful celebrating the festival, Commissioner Ogunlowo implored citizens to cooperate with all security agencies to ensure a safer environment during the celebration period.
Officers will be conducting stop-and-search operations as part of the heightened security measures to maintain peace and order throughout the festive period.
